The Colorado owner of a Great Dane was shocked when her dog gave birth to an Irish green puppy.

The three-year-old Great Dane gave birth to nine healthy puppies. However, the eighth puppy was tinted green, ABC7 reports.

Green puppies are a rare phenomena that occur when a dog’s light-colored fur gets dyed by the green-pigmented bile in the mother’s placenta, called Biliverdin, when they are in the womb.

A puppy’s green coloring is not detrimental to their health and eventually grows out.
